TradingView Plans
TradingView has a plan for every trader and investor, starting by using the Free Basic Plan, which offers access to basic functionalities like one chart, bar replay, and seven years of financial information. Upgrade to Pro to gain more advanced integrated trading tools, no advertisements, and social network access. And for even more, Pro+ gives you access to different types of intraday charts and custom spread formulas and also the ability to export data and use more indicators per chart.
TradingView Free Basic Plan
The TradingView Basic Plan is the beginning pack to the world of trading. All you need is an email account to get started and you’ll get access to basic tools like charts, bar replay across different timeframes, as well as 7 decades of financial historical data. Additionally, you’ll be able to access to essential analysis tools such as auto Fib Retracements and multi-timeframe analysis. But keep in mind, there will be advertisements in this plan.
TradingView Pro
Ready to step up your trading abilities? The Pro plan is where it’s at. You’ll be able to access better tools and features, with no ads, and a complete community of traders to connect with. With this plan, you’ll be able to open two charts in a tab and save up to five chart layouts, make use of the bar replay on all time frames and access 20 years of historical financial information. Plus, you can use 5 indicators on a chart, create customized trading indicators make use of volume profile indicators, and create as many as 20 notifications on price, strategies, drawings or indicators.
TradingView Pro+
Want even better control of the charts you use? This Pro+ plan is for you. The plan offers the capability to open up to 4 charts per tab and keep up to 10 chart layouts, and access to more intraday chart types, including Renko, Kagi, Point & Figure as well as Line Break. Plus, you can export strategies, employ at least 10 indicator charts, and set as many alerts as you like, and many more.
TradingView Premium
The ultimate plan for the most experienced trader. The Premium Plan lets you have access to every feature TradingView provides, such as first priority support, eight charts per tab and the ability to store unlimited numbers of saved chart layouts. One of the greatest options is the time intervals that are ideal when trading on the day. You can also utilize more than 25 indicators per chart and set the possibility of up to 400 alerts on strategies, drawings as well as prices, indicators and drawings. Plus, you’ll have access to all the social functions of TradingView, such as the exclusive badge on you name. You also have the capability to publish invite-only indicators and secure scripts as well as videos. ideas as well as public suggestions, the option of a signature field and a website.

TradingView Pricing
TradingView offers a variety different pricing plans that are simple to understand. You can start with the free Basic plan or upgrade to one of the paid options. The Pro plan begins from $14.95 per month, while the Pro+ plan is $29.95 per month, and the Premium plan costs $59.95 monthly. You can also save money by signing up for an annual plan. For example the Pro plan is $155.40 annually, while the Pro+ plan is $299.40 annually, and the Premium plan costs $599.40 annually. That’s like getting 2 months of free time!

Data Feeds, News and Market Data
TradingView offers free real-time data whenever possible. However, some exchanges charge the payment of a monthly fee to access real-time tick data , and they only provide delayed data at no cost. For instance, with a TradingView membership, users will receive free real-time US data on stocks from the Cboe BZX Exchange (formerly known as BATS exchange) which is responsible for about 10% of all market activity in the US stock market. If you’d like to be able to see 100% of all trades, ticks, and transactions, you’ll need to subscribe to various markets that have real-time data. These are the monthly fees for a real-time data feed
Nasdaq: $3
NYSE: $3
Arca: $9
CME Group (S&P E-mini included): $4
OTC Markets: $2
TradingView offers data feeds from 16 North-American, 31 European 9 Middle East/African, 34 Asian/Pacific and 9 Mexican/South American exchanges. which some of them are free of charge with real-time data. Others have the option of a monthly fee that is low. TradingView doesn’t profit from these costs however they are collected per regulations by the exchanges. Be aware that a paid TradingView plan is needed to sign up to live data feeds.
